Joya Barnett, Photography
Joya Barnett joined Community Artists Gallery & Studios in 2017. Joya finds inspiration in her Christian faith, in nature, and in music, which was her field of study. She loves fusing scripture & original poetry with the photos & will some times hunt for just the right picture to fit a certain lyric. "I always wanted to paint but wasn't very good at it," Joya admits. "Turns out, it wasn't a brush, but a camera, that could capture what the eyes of my heart were seeing." She is a graduate of Craven Community College.

Belinda Scheber, Painting
Belinda Scheber paints in acrylic and watercolor. One of her paintings was selected as the official art work for New Bern’s 2017 Mum Fest. She studied geology and geography at George Mason University and the University of New Mexico, which led to a career as a civil servant and cartographer with the U.S. Army. Since retiring to New Bern from Washington, D.C., Belinda has been inspired by the beauty of coastal North Carolina, and her favorite subjects are nature, wildlife and still life. “I love to express God's beauty in painting,” she says. Belinda has taken many art classes and is a member of the Coastal Carolinas Plein Air Painters, and Twin Rivers Artists Association. Her work is visible on the online gallery Daily Paintworks.
